The Fifth Assessment Report of the IPCC. The Fifth Assessment Report (AR5) of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) was published in 2014 (the next Assessment Report, AR6 will be published in 2022). About half of global climate finance should be devoted to adaptation, the UN secretary-general ...Oct 5, 2021 · Decade of climate breakdown saw 14 per cent of coral reefs vanish. Reef fish and corals in the waters of the Seychelles archipelago. Between 2009 and 2018, the continuous rise in sea temperature cost the world 14 per cent of its coral reefs – that’s more than the size of Australia’s reefs combined – a UN-backed report revealed on Tuesday. 20 thg 11, 2023 ... ... Historical responsibility for climate change is at the heart of debates over climate justice.. History matters because the cumulative amount of carbon dioxide (CO2) emitted since the start of the industrial revolution is closely tied to the 1.2C of warming that has already occurred..
